Hey besties! Guess what? I had an amazing vacation in Tulum, Mexico! 🇲🇽 It was at Christmas and I am only writing about it now, but it was so much fun with the beaches and the cenotes the ruins but most all .... The food!


One night we went to this super restaurant (and a bit overly fancy) restaurant called Arca.

It's a cool place by the beach where you sit outside and hope it doesn't rain. Thankfully for us, it didn't. But there were lots of trees so it felt like sitting in the jungle. It felt like we were having dinner in a super fancy backyard. My parents said the style was "bohemian chic," whatever that means. 🤷‍♀️


Okay, now for the part I like to talk about … the food! It was all "farm-to-table" and influenced by ancient Mayan cuisine. I had never had ancient Mayan food before, but it was mostly delicious. We had 10 courses (which was too much) and while I can't remember it all, there are a few dishes that I just can't forget.


We had a seafood ceviche. It was an acidic and tangy delight, with the bright citrus of freshly squeezed lime juice infusing every bite. It was so nice and really made the natural flavors of the seafood shine through while being perfectly complemented by a medley of crisp herbs, fresh vegetables, and a touch of heat. The combination is vibrant and flavorful, offering a refreshing and satisfying experience with every forkful.

Rating: 8/10

We also had some Camarones tacos. Truth told, these might have been from another restaurant on the same street, but I am giving credit to Arca because they were delicious. It was a simple bite that and a feast of textures all in one. The shrimp were coated in a light, golden batter, fried to perfection, and offering an irresistible crunch that contrasts beautifully with the tender, juicy seafood inside. They were wrapped within warm, soft tortillas, they’re topped with a crisp, tangy slaw that adds freshness and a delightful crunch of its own. A drizzle of creamy, spiced sauce ties it all together, while a squeeze of fresh lime juice adds a zesty burst that lifts the entire dish.

Rating: 9/10

But the best dish (definitely from Arca) was the seared halibut. It was beautifully cooked, with a golden, crisp exterior and a tender, flaky inside that was packed with flavor. It was paired with a medley of fresh, crunchy vegetables that added a delightful burst of texture and brightness to the dish. The vibrant green sauce, though flavorful and aromatic, had a touch more spice than I usually like, but I ate it and despite the heat, the dish was well-balanced and delicious.

Rating: 8.5/10 a little bit too spicy for me but it was still delicious!

Now, was Arca a good place to go with your family? 🤔

Well, the restaurant was a bit overly grown-up and the menu was too big and it was all fixed course and it was expensive. But the waiters were still really nice and it's beautiful and its an amazing experience so even if there are some downsides, I would recommend it.

If you're ever in Tulum, you should totally check it out! Just maybe ask your parents to see the menu first if you're a super picky eater. 😉
